In hydrologic monitoring, winches are typically used to retrieve sensors and other equipment that have been deployed in rivers, lakes, or other water bodies. These sensors measure water temperature, pH, dissolved oxygen, turbidity, and other parameters essential for understanding water quality. By using winches, monitoring personnel can safely and efficiently retrieve these sensors, ensuring accurate data collection and minimizing equipment damage.
Moreover, winches are also essential for retrieving equipment from remote or dangerous locations. In some cases, sensors may be deployed in areas that are difficult to access, such as deep lakes or rapids. Using winches, monitoring personnel can safely retrieve these sensors without putting themselves at risk. Additionally, winches can also be used to lower sensors into the water body, providing a complete solution for deployment and retrieval of monitoring equipment.
